Lawn overseeding and reseeding in Spearfish typically costs between $150 and $500, with an average near $300. The total cost depends on the size of the lawn, the type of grass seed used, and the condition of the existing turf.
Local contractors in Spearfish charge approximately $40 to $70 per hour for labor. Depending on the project, permits may be required from the Spearfish Planning Department, though overseeding typically does not require a permit unless it involves extensive land alteration.
When comparing quotes from Spearfish contractors, ensure they include seed type, application method, and any necessary follow-up care in their estimates. This will give you a clearer understanding of the value being offered.
Licensed overseeding contractors in Spearfish typically charge $40–$70/hr. Rates may vary depending on the season, with peak demand in spring generally resulting in higher prices.
Overseeding usually does not require permits from the Spearfish Planning Department, making it a straightforward project for homeowners. However, consultation is recommended for any major changes to lawn structure.
Choosing the right type of seed can influence your costs by 15–25%. High-quality seed might be more expensive initially but can lead to a healthier lawn and reduced maintenance in the long run.
The best time to overseed a lawn in Spearfish is during late summer to early fall when temperatures are cooler, and moisture levels are higher. Scheduling during these times can optimize seed germination.
Overseeding a lawn that has a significant weed presence is generally not recommended, as weeds can compete with new grass seed for nutrients and water, leading to poor establishment of the new grass. In Spearfish, it’s essential to manage weeds before overseeding to give your new grass the best chance of thriving. This may involve applying a selective herbicide or manually removing weeds prior to the overseeding process. If the weed problem is extensive, it may be more effective to consider a complete renovation of your lawn. By addressing the weed issue first, you can create a healthier environment for your new grass to grow, resulting in a lush, vibrant lawn.
The amount of seed required for overseeding your lawn in Spearfish depends on the area size and the type of grass you are using. As a general guideline, most grass types require about 5 to 10 pounds of seed per 1,000 square feet for overseeding. It's important to select the right seed variety that matches your existing lawn type for optimal results. Additionally, the condition of your lawn plays a role; if your lawn is severely thinning, you may want to increase the seeding rate to promote quicker coverage. Consulting with a local lawn care professional can help you determine the right amount of seed needed based on your specific situation and ensure successful overseeding.
Overseeding offers several significant benefits to your lawn. In Spearfish, overseeding can help improve the density of your grass, which not only enhances its appearance but also increases its ability to resist drought, pests, and diseases. Thicker grass can also help choke out weeds, reducing the need for chemical treatments. Additionally, overseeding can introduce new grass varieties that are better suited to local climate conditions or that have improved disease resistance. This leads to a more resilient lawn that can thrive throughout the changing seasons. Overall, overseeding is a strategic investment in the health and beauty of your property, making it a worthwhile consideration for any homeowner.
Overseeding and reseeding are both methods used to improve lawn health, but they serve different purposes. In Spearfish, overseeding involves spreading grass seed over an existing lawn to thicken it and improve its resilience without tearing up the current grass. This is particularly beneficial for lawns that are thinning or have bare patches due to wear and tear or environmental stress. On the other hand, reseeding typically involves removing the old grass and planting new seed in its place, which is necessary when the lawn is severely damaged or has undergone disease. Understanding these differences can help you decide which method is best for your lawn's specific needs, ensuring a lush and vibrant outdoor space.
The optimal time for overseeding your lawn in Spearfish generally falls in the early spring or late summer to early fall. During these periods, temperatures are conducive to grass seed germination, and there is often adequate rainfall to support new growth. Early spring overseeding allows for quick establishment before the summer heat sets in, while late summer to early fall overseeding takes advantage of cooler temperatures and increased moisture, which are ideal conditions for seed growth. Timing your overseeding correctly can significantly impact the success of your lawn, resulting in a thicker, healthier lawn that can withstand the challenges posed by local climate conditions.
